Catalog description

This course is designed for Respiratory Therapy students and aims to familiarize them with the general classification of drugs, their mechanisms of action, indications, contraindications, and major adverse effects. Principles of drug administration and pharmacokinetics are also presented. The course will comprehensively cover most classifications of medications; however, specific attention will be devoted to the growing field of medications used in respiratory therapy. Prerequisites: Admission in the Respiratory Therapy program.
